Leaders file nomination for speaker post
Team Udayavani, May 24, 2018, 4:17 PM IST
Bengaluru: Senior Congress pioneer and former minister K R Ramesh Kumar on Thursday May 24 recorded nomination for the post of the speaker of Legislative Assembly in Bengaluru.
Deputy CM G Parameshwara, former CM Siddaramaiah and different leaders went with Ramesh Kumar while presenting the nomination papers to Legislative Assembly Chief Secretary S Murthy. Then, Suresh Kumar from the BJP too recorded his nomination for the speaker’s post.
The election for the speaker’s post will be held on Friday May 25 at 12.30 pm. Ramesh Kumar from the Congress is probably going to get chosen since the JD(S)- Congress join has the required number after post-survey organization together.
The deputy speaker will be from the JD(S). K Srinivas Gowda and A T Ramaswamy of the JD(S) are in the race for the post.
JD(S) state president H D Kumaraswamy took oath as the Chief Minister on May 23 at 4.30 pm. Dr G Parameshwara was confirmed as the Karnataka’s first Dalit Deputy Chief Minister.
